#4374fb h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4374fb is composed of 26.3% red, 45.5%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.3% cyan, 53.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 224 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 62.4%. #4374fb color hex could be obtained by blending #86e8ff with #0000f7.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

● #4374fb color description : Bright blue.
The hexadecimal color #4374fb has RGB values of R:67, G:116,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 4420859.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000104 is the darkest color, while #f0f4ff is the lightest one.
